Our School Rules

Although the ATA has specific rules of etiquette, our school has our own set of rules that we expect our students to follow.

 
We believe that discipline is freedom. It should be understood by members that the purpose of these rules is primarily to ensure maximum benefit from the study of Taekwondo. The basic principles found in these rules have been a part of Taekwondo from its inception.
   
 1.  Bow to the flags and your instructor when entering and leaving the school. This is to show courtesy and respect.

 

 2.  Do not enter or leave class without permission from your instructor.
   
 3.  Students should bow before speaking to the instructor and use words of consideration such as "yes, sir", "no, sir" and "excuse me, sir".
 
 4.  No eating or drinking is allowed inside the school (except for water in the dressing or viewing areas).
  
 5.  Please remove shoes and socks before entering the training area.
  
 6.  Please use the restroom before class begins.
 
 7.  No one is allowed to use any equipment without permission.
 
 8.  Sparring gear is mandatory for all ages.
 
 9.  All students are expected to be courteous and understanding. Advanced students are expected to set a good example to new students and to assist such students whenever necessary.
 
10.  Loud conversation, improper language, chewing gum in class or "horse play" have no place in a Taekwondo school.
 
11.  Your uniform should be clean and pressed at all times.
 
12.  Any substitute teacher should be treated as your regular instructor.
 
13.  Do not give a demonstration or teach Taekwondo without the approval of your instructor.
 
14.  No jewelry should be worn during class except for a wedding band.
 
15.  Do not engage in any activities that might degrade the code of Taekwondo ethics or the reputation of the school. 
 
16.  You must have the approval of the School before participating in any tournament competition.
 
17. Participation in any other school, except your own, should be with your instructor's consent.
 
18. Women and girls are required to wear white t-shirts under their uniform at all times. Men and boys should only wear their uniform tops with no t-shirt.
   
ANY DEVIATION FROM THE ABOVE MENTIONED RULES COULD RESULT IN DISMISSAL FROM THE SCHOOL.
